Firstly, if you find a drowning person, you should get them out of the water in time. If you do not know how to rescue them in the water and the water conditions at the scene, you can use the tools next to them, such as ropes and lifebuoys and other things to save them, do not save them blindly. Secondly, place the drowning person on a flat surface after rescuing him/her from the water and first remove any foreign objects such as silt or water plants from the mouth, nose and throat to ensure smooth breathing. Finally, if the drowning person’s breathing is weak, artificial respiration should be used immediately. If the drowning person’s heart has stopped, CPR should be performed immediately to help restore the heartbeat.
